Что такое круговой двусвязный список?
Что такое круговой двусвязный список?

Видео: Что такое круговой двусвязный список?

Видео: Что такое круговой двусвязный список?
Видео: Двусвязный и кольцевой список (linked list) - Структуры данных C# 2024, Ноябрь
Anonim

Круговой двусвязный список представляет собой более сложный тип структуры данных, в которой узел содержит указатели на свой предыдущий узел, а также на следующий узел. Первый узел список также содержат адрес последнего узла в его предыдущем указателе. А круговой двусвязный список показано на следующем рисунке.

Кроме того, что объясняет двусвязный список?

А двусвязный список это своего рода связанный список с ссылка к предыдущему узлу, а также к точке данных и ссылка к следующему узлу в список так же по отдельности связанный список . Сторожевой или нулевой узел указывает на конец список . Двусвязные списки обычно реализованы в псевдокоде в учебниках по информатике.

Также можно спросить, в чем преимущество двусвязного списка? Ниже приведены преимущества / недостатки двусвязного списка по отдельности связанный список . 1) DLL можно перемещать как в прямом, так и в обратном направлении. 2) Операция удаления в DLL более эффективна, если указан указатель на удаляемый узел. 3) Мы можем быстро вставить новый узел перед полученным узлом.

Люди также спрашивают, что такое круговой связанный список?

А круговой связанный список представляет собой последовательность элементов, в которой каждый элемент имеет ссылка к следующему элементу в этой последовательности, а последний элемент имеет ссылка к первому элементу. Это означает круговой связанный список похож на одиночный связанный список за исключением того, что последний узел указывает на первый узел в список.

Зачем нужен двусвязный список?

а двусвязный список потребностей больше операций при вставке или удалении, и это потребности больше места (для хранения дополнительного указателя). А двусвязный список можно перемещаться в обоих направлениях (вперед и назад). В одиночку связанный список можно пройти только в одном направлении.

Рекомендуемые: